Official abstract text for this publication.
The disclosed cover glass is produced by etching a glass substrate that has been formed by a down-drawing process, and chemically strengthening the glass substrate to provide the glass substrate with a compressive-stress layer on the principal surfaces thereof. The glass substrate contains, as components thereof, 50% to 70% by mass of SiO 2 , 5% to 20% by mass of Al 2 O 3 , 6% to 30% by mass of Na 2 O, and 0% to less than 8% by mass of Li 2 O. The glass substrate may also contain 0% to 2.6% by mass of CaO, if necessary. The glass substrate has an etching characteristic in which the etching rate is at least 3.7 μm/minute in an etching environment having a temperature of 22° C. and containing hydrogen fluoride with a concentration of 10% by mass.

What is claimed is: 1. A cover glass comprising: a plate-shaped glass substrate having a compressive-stress layer on principal surfaces thereof, the glass substrate containing, as components thereof, 50% to 67% by mass of SiO 2 , 5% to 20% by mass of Al 2 O 3 , 10% to 15.4% by mass of Na 2 O, 0% to 1% by mass of Li 2 O, 0% to less than 4% by mass of K 2 O, substantially no CaO, 0% to less than 0.1% by mass of ZrO 2 , 0% to 1% by mass of TiO 2 , 0% to 5% by mass of B 2 O 3 , and greater than 1% to 15% by mass of MgO, the ratio of the content of K 2 O to R 2 O (K 2 O/R 2 O) of the substrate being from 0 to 0.08, and the ratio of the content of ZrO 2 and TiO 2 to SiO 2 ((ZrO 2 +TiO 2 )/SiO 2 ) of the substrate being from 0 to 0.01, and if the content by percentage of the SiO 2 is X % by mass and the content by percentage of the Al 2 O 3 is Y % by mass, X-½·Y is 45% to 57.5% by mass. 2. The cover glass according to claim 1 , wherein the compressive-stress layer is formed on an end surface of the cover glass. 3. The cover glass according to claim 1 , wherein the glass substrate has an etching characteristic in which an etching rate is at least 3.7 μm/minute in an etching environment having a temperature of 22° C. and containing hydrogen fluoride with a concentration of 10% by mass. 4. The cover glass according to claim 1 , wherein the glass substrate is formed into a plate-like shape by a down-drawing process. 5. The cover glass according to claim 1 , wherein the glass substrate contains substantially no K 2 O. 6. The cover glass according to claim 1 , wherein the glass substrate has a strain point of 580° C. or more. 7. The cover glass according to claim 1 , wherein the depth of the compressive stress layer range is 47.7 μm to 90.0 μm.
